EO 14042 ESPC PROJECT FOR NAVAL BASE GUAM, MARIANAS COVID SAFETY PROTOCOL is a federal award for Department of Defense (DOD) held by JOHNSON CONTROLS GOVERNMENT SYSTEMS LIMITED LIABILITY COMPANY. Estimated value $34.1M ($9.1M obligated). Current period of performance ends Mar 31, 2028. Last award drew 21 bidders.

JOHNSON CONTROLS GOVERNMENT SYSTEMS LIMITED LIABILITY COMPANY holds $313.1M across 75 federal awards, concentrated at Department of Defense (DOD). This PIID sits alongside 4 related awards under parent DEAM3697EE73568. Competition previously drew 21 offers. Recompete timing centers on the Mar 31, 2028 PoP end — agencies typically plan 12–18 months ahead.
